2020-2021 Season Show details...

The pandemic, which started in 2020, continued into 2021 and seriously disrupted YSPF plans for the 2020–2021 season. Concerts with a live audience were not permitted, because of the danger of spreading the disease. As an alternative, the YSPF recorded videos of performances by some of its young artists. So far, the YSPF has recorded videos on:

  • Saturday 23 January 2021 Program
    Recorded at the:
    Conservatoire de musique de Gatineau
    430 blvd Alexandre-Taché, Gatineau QC
  • Saturday 27 February 2021 Program
    Recorded at the:
    First Unitarian Congregation
    30 Cleary Ave., Ottawa ON
  • April 2021 Program
    Recorded in the homes of the performers or in the facilities of their respective music schools
  • June 2021 Program
    Recorded in the homes of the performers or in the facilities of their respective music schools, together with a special video provided by Jonathan Crow, Concertmaster of the Toronto Symphony Orchestra and a member of the YSPF’s Artistic Advisory Board.

  • a “Musical Exchange with Vienna”

    From 7 to 14 October, the YSPF took a group of thirteen young musicians to Vienna. This “Musical Exchange with Vienna” was organized in co-operation with Vienna’s Johann Sebastian Bach Music School (JSBM). The musicians, either current or past performers in YSPF concerts, were accompanied on the trip by YSPF president Joan Milkson and several parents. The young performers presented three concerts in churches in Vienna and three concerts together with students of the JSBM.

    We would like to thank everyone who supported and encouraged the YSPF Ensemble on the “Musical Exchange with Vienna.” This was an amazing musical and cultural experience for our young musicians. They were incredible representatives for Canada and we can not wait to welcome the Vienna “Young Masters” of the JSBM to Ottawa later in 2016!
